Functional characterization of BRCA1 sequence variants using a yeast small colony phenotype assay.

Abstract excerpt
Germline mutations that inactivate the tumor suppressor gene BRCA1 are associated with an increased risk of cancers of the breast and other tissues, but the functional consequence of many missense variants found in the human population is uncertain.
